mirror of
https://github.com/mikefarah/yq.git
synced 2025-01-26 08:25:38 +00:00
Updated release instructions, remove gate for release
This commit is contained in:
parent
8ee6f7dc1a
commit
6a05e517f1
1
.github/workflows/release.yml
vendored
1
.github/workflows/release.yml
vendored
@ -6,7 +6,6 @@ on:
|
||||
|
||||
jobs:
|
||||
publishGitRelease:
|
||||
environment: gitrelease
|
||||
runs-on: ubuntu-latest
|
||||
steps:
|
||||
- uses: actions/checkout@v2
|
||||
|
@ -1,16 +1,9 @@
|
||||
- increment version in version.go
|
||||
- increment version in snapcraft.yaml
|
||||
- commit
|
||||
- tag git with same version number
|
||||
- make sure local build passes
|
||||
- push tag to git
|
||||
- 3.4.0, v3
|
||||
- git push --tags
|
||||
- make local xcompile (builds binaries for all platforms)
|
||||
|
||||
- git release
|
||||
./scripts/release.sh
|
||||
./scripts/upload.sh
|
||||
- tag git with same version number
|
||||
- commit vX tag - this will trigger github actions
|
||||
- use github actions to publish docker and make github release
|
||||
|
||||
- snapcraft
|
||||
- will auto create a candidate, test it works then promote
|
||||
|
Loading…
Reference in New Issue
Block a user